HTML 动态添加list
时间: 2024-03-05 18:46:26 浏览: 74
动态添加listview
在HTML中,可以使用JavaScript来实现动态添加列表项。以下常见的实现方式:
1. 首先,在HTML文件中创建一个空的列表,例如使用`<ul>`标签表示无序列表或使用`<ol>`标签表示有序列表。
2. 在JavaScript中,使用DOM操作来获取到列表元素,可以通过`document.getElementById()`或`document.querySelector()`等方法获取到列表的引用。
3. 使用JavaScript创建一个新的列表项元素,可以使用`document.createElement()`方法来创建一个新的`<li>`标签。
4. 设置新创建的列表项的内容,可以使用`textContent`属性或`innerHTML`属性来设置列表项的文本内容。
5. 将新创建的列表项添加到列表中,可以使用`appendChild()`方法将新创建的列表项添加为列表的子元素。
下面是一个示例代码:
HTML部分:
```html
<ul id="myList">
</ul>
```
JavaScript部分:
```javascript
// 获取列表元素
var myList = document.getElementById("myList");
// 创建新的列表项
var newItem = document.createElement("li");
// 设置列表项的内容
newItem.textContent = "新的列表项";
// 将新的列表项添加到列表中
myList.appendChild(newItem);
```
这样,就可以通过JavaScript动态地向HTML列表中添加新的列表项了。
阅读全文